BC Home + Garden Show features and celebrity talent 2024

Marketplace Events announced its top must-see features and high-profile talent that will be at the upcoming BC Home + Garden Show, happening February 8-11, 2024 at BC Place Stadium. The Show returns next month with locally- and nationally-recognized industry professionals who have an incredible depth of experience and expertise to help Lower Mainlanders jumpstart any home and garden project this new year, big or small. 

Learn about the top attractions Vancouverites won’t want to miss at this year’s Show:

Explore the innovative concept of small-scale vacationing with BC’s own Hewing Haus. Take a tour of Hewing Haus‘ 700 sq ft unit, featuring two bedrooms and one bathroom. This compact yet spacious design includes a full kitchen, a custom fireplace, and floor-to-ceiling windows, all crafted for sustainability and efficiency. The outdoor space is thoughtfully designed to offer all the essential functionalities with an added touch of enjoyment, making it an ideal vacation home for a small family.

Pizza, pizza, pizza

Ever wished for a pizza oven outdoors? Now, it’s possible. Visit the Show’s first-ever Pizza Pop-up Shop, presented by Ooni and Kerrisdale Lumber Home and experience firsthand the excellence of an Ooni pizza oven, crafted by Canada’s top pizza chef. Ooni pizza ovens reach temperatures of up to 500°C, allowing you to cook incredible pizzas in just 60 seconds. The BC Home + Garden Show runs from Thursday, February 8 at 11:00 a.m. to Sunday, February 11 at 5:00 p.m. at BC Place Stadium.
